Studying Online at Mercer University

Distance learning is available at Mercer University. Of 9,196 students, 2,029 (22%) studied exclusively online and 1,218 (13%) took at least some classes online.

Human Resources Development Bachelor’s Program at Mercer University

Among the 6 bachelor’s human resources development graduates at Mercer University, 100% were women (6) and 0% were men (0).

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Human Resources Development bachelor’s degree recipients at Mercer University.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 1
Black / African American 5
Racial-ethnic diversity of Human Resources Development majors at Mercer University

Minority students account for 83% of Human Resources Development bachelor’s degree recipients at Mercer University, higher than the national average of 41%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
